Market Snapshot: Solvent-Based Plastic Recycling Market Overview
The Solvent-based Plastic Recycling Market grew from USD 593.44 million in 2024 to USD 630.77 million in 2025. It is expected to continue growing at a CAGR of 6.63%, reaching USD 992.29 million by 2032. Robust adoption is driven by the growing regulatory focus on advanced recycling, brand owner commitments to recycled content, and evolving trade policies. The market is seeing substantial technology investment, partnerships across the value chain, and increasing demand across packaging, automotive, and textile sectors.

Key Takeaways for Decision-Makers
- Solvent-based recycling enables recovery of high-purity polymers from challenging streams, positioning it above conventional mechanical approaches for demanding industrial use.
- Growing global adoption is linked to stricter regulations, brand sustainability mandates, and enhanced collaboration across technology, chemical, and waste management firms for knowledge transfer and risk management.
- Feedstock diversity and process innovation allow this technology to address multilayer films and post-industrial residues, expanding access to non-traditional and previously underutilized polymer sources.
- End-use industries—particularly packaging, textiles, and automotive—leverage these recycled materials to achieve sustainability targets and maintain stringent quality standards.
- Digital tracking and certification are supporting full transparency in the supply chain, essential for compliance with recycled content standards and for building brand trust.
- Strategic alliances and R&D investments are focused on lowering energy consumption, enhancing solvent recovery, and expanding modular deployment to address evolving operational needs.
Tariff Impact: Navigating US Trade Measures in Solvent-Based Plastic Recycling
New US tariffs impacting polymer imports and intermediates from 2025 are recalibrating supply chains, with domestic recyclers accelerating investments to protect margins and access alternative feedstock streams. Transitional policies—such as tariff rate quotas and certification carve-outs—support market flexibility and sustainability compliance. These shifts are prompting accelerated adoption of solvent-based recycling to help organizations maintain resilience in cost structures and supply reliability.
